Chartham station, although unstaffed, is well-equipped with essential facilities to cater to its passengers. While there is no traditional ticket office, the station hosts ticket machines for purchasing and collecting tickets bought online. For those who need assistance, help points are available. It's noteworthy that the station lacks a dedicated waiting room, toilets, and refreshment facilities, encouraging commuters to plan accordingly.
Accessibility-wise, Chartham offers step-free access and a degree of platform ramping, making travel more convenient for those with mobility needs. However, bear in mind that the station doesn't have accessible toilets or specific setup for impaired mobility set-down. Those who plan to cycle to the station will find bicycle storage facilities, but it's always best to use caution as the area is not monitored by CCTV.
For those looking to explore beyond Chartham, the station’s transport links make onward travel effortless. Regular bus services are conveniently located on the A28 Ashford Road, offering connections in both directions. Millbrook might be small, but it offers essential amenities for its travelers. However, keep in mind that there is no ticket office or ticket machines on-site, so purchasing tickets online prior is recommended. The presence of an induction loop makes communication accessible for those with hearing impairments. Additionally, there are help points available, although no staff assistance is offered at this station.
Accessibility is a significant focus here, with step-free access available, albeit with possible long or steep ramps between platforms. Note that there is no waiting room, and while seating is available, other amenities such as toilets, refreshment facilities, and a car park are absent.
